Cleanroom Airtight Sliding Door Market - Global Forecast 2026-2032

The Cleanroom Airtight Sliding Door Market size was estimated at USD 1.57 billion in 2025 and expected to reach USD 1.67 billion in 2026, at a CAGR of 7.16% to reach USD 2.56 billion by 2032.

Unveiling the Critical Role of Airtight Sliding Doors in Contamination Control Environments and Their Strategic Importance to High-Tech Industries

In environments where contamination control is non-negotiable, airtight sliding doors serve as the frontline defense against particulate intrusion and microbial infiltration. These specialized portals are engineered to maintain precise pressure differentials, thereby safeguarding sensitive operations in biotechnology labs, pharmaceutical production suites, semiconductor fabrication plants, and advanced food and beverage processing facilities.

By integrating advanced sealing technologies with rigorous design standards, these doors ensure that the sterile barrier between cleanroom classes remains uncompromised. Their deployment not only reflects compliance with stringent regulatory frameworks but also demonstrates a facility’s dedication to operational integrity. As industries increasingly prioritize product purity and yield consistency, the strategic importance of reliable sliding door solutions continues to climb.

Moreover, the advent of digital monitoring and predictive maintenance has infused traditional door systems with new levels of performance transparency. Real-time diagnostics and automated alerting capabilities are now embedded into door assemblies, enabling facility managers to anticipate service needs and minimize downtime. In essence, airtight sliding doors have evolved from mere architectural elements into critical components of an integrated contamination control strategy.

How Evolving Regulatory Mandates and Technological Innovations Are Redefining the Standards for Cleanroom Airtight Sliding Door Solutions

The landscape of cleanroom operations is undergoing a profound transformation driven by escalating quality mandates, technological breakthroughs, and shifting supply chain imperatives. Regulatory agencies worldwide are tightening standards for particulate and bioburden levels, compelling manufacturers to adopt door solutions that deliver ever-finer sealing performance and documentation.

Concurrently, the march of Industry 4.0 technologies has permeated even the most isolated environments. Intelligent door assemblies now feature integrated sensors that feed data into centralized facility management systems, facilitating energy optimization and predictive issue resolution. Robotics and automation further enhance throughput, with doors designed to interface seamlessly with automated guided vehicles and robotic arms.

Sustainability considerations are also reshaping material selection and life-cycle assessments. The demand for low-carbon, recyclable materials has prompted innovation in aluminum framing and high-performance polymer seals. This pivot not only supports corporate environmental goals but also reduces total cost of ownership through enhanced durability and fewer replacement cycles.

Taken together, these shifts are redefining buyer expectations, as stakeholders seek door systems that not only meet stringent cleanliness criteria but also deliver digital intelligence, sustainability benefits, and supply chain resilience.

Examining the Economic Consequences of Recent U.S. Section 232 Tariff Adjustments on Steel and Aluminum Imports Affecting Cleanroom Door Manufacturing

The reinstatement and escalation of U.S. Section 232 tariffs on steel and aluminum imports have profound implications for manufacturers of cleanroom airtight sliding doors. On February 11, 2025, the administration closed existing exemptions and restored a uniform 25 percent duty on these metals, effective March 12, 2025, ending tariff-rate quotas and product exclusion processes that had previously softened the impact. This policy shift immediately increased the cost base for door frame materials, as both structural steel and aircraft-grade aluminum now carry steeper import levies.

Further intensifying the market disturbance, a subsequent proclamation raised these tariffs to 50 percent on steel and aluminum imports beginning June 4, 2025, heightening supply chain volatility and compelling domestic manufacturers to reassess sourcing strategies. The steel tariff hike drew attention from domestic and international stakeholders; Canadian and European suppliers, once exempt, now faced substantial duties, prompting many to redirect volumes to other regions or seek local partnerships to maintain market access.

As a consequence, door producers have confronted higher procurement outlays and extended lead times. Some have initiated reengineering efforts to optimize material usage and explore alternative alloys, while others have accelerated strategic alliances with U.S. steel and aluminum mills. Ultimately, these tariff measures underscore the need for agile sourcing frameworks and proactive cost management to sustain competitive pricing and protect profit margins in a rapidly shifting trade environment.

Decoding Market Segmentation Dynamics to Reveal Distinct Demand Drivers Across End Uses, Classes, Operations, Materials, and Installation Types

The cleanroom airtight sliding door market exhibits a nuanced tapestry of demand drivers shaped by distinct application requirements and operational contexts. Biotechnology sectors frequently mandate doors that accommodate sensitive biological processes, whereas food and beverage facilities prioritize hygienic surfaces and rapid cycle rates to meet production throughput. Semiconductor fabs demand ultra-precise particulate control and integration with automated wafer transfer systems. Within pharmaceutical applications, both biologics and solid dosage lines impose rigorous standards, prompting specialized sealing profiles and material compatibilities.

Cleanroom classes span from the most stringent low-particulate environments between Class 100 and 1,000 to broader classifications ranging up to Class 100,000. Each class level dictates target leakage rates, door panel materials, and sealing systems, with research laboratories often opting for higher-grade specifications to mitigate contamination risks. Operation types further diversify the landscape: automatic sliding doors deliver hands-free access and programmable cycle parameters, while manual models offer cost-effective simplicity in less critical zones.

Material selection underpins both functional performance and lifecycle economics. Aluminum frames balance lightweight durability and corrosion resistance, glass panels facilitate visual inspection and lighting optimization, PVC assemblies offer chemical inertness, and stainless steel variants deliver unmatched robustness for aggressive cleaning protocols. Installation modality also factors prominently; new construction projects allow for integrated design considerations, whereas retrofit installations demand modular solutions that minimize downtime.

This segmentation matrix reveals that no single door configuration fits all scenarios. Instead, informed decision makers align door system specifications with the intersection of end-use requirements, cleanroom classifications, operational workflows, material preferences, and installation contexts.

Evaluating Regional Market Nuances and Growth Potential for Airtight Sliding Doors Across the Americas, Europe Middle East Africa, and Asia-Pacific

Regional dynamics in the airtight sliding door market reflect diverse regulatory frameworks, infrastructure investments, and industrial priorities. In the Americas, heightened biopharma manufacturing investments and semiconductor fab expansions in Mexico and the United States are driving demand for high-performance door systems. Leading players in North America are responding with localized manufacturing footprints to mitigate tariff impacts and ensure rapid delivery.

Across Europe, the Middle East, and Africa, stringent EU cleanroom standards and an evolving pharmaceutical landscape are key growth enablers. Countries such as Germany and Switzerland, with established biotech clusters, frequently update facility guidelines, creating continuous demand for door upgrades. In the Middle East, significant investments in advanced food processing and halal pharmaceutical production spur adoption, while African markets are gradually embracing cleanroom technologies, propelled by public-private partnerships.

The Asia-Pacific region remains the fastest-growing market segment, fueled by robust semiconductor capital expenditure in Taiwan, South Korea, and China. Pharmaceutical manufacturing hubs in India and China are likewise scaling biologics capacity, fostering installations of automated door solutions. Local manufacturers are rapidly innovating to capture market share, often offering integrated systems that bundle doors with environmental monitoring and access control functionalities. This regional mosaic underscores the imperative for market participants to calibrate product portfolios and go-to-market strategies with local regulatory, operational, and supply chain nuances.

Profiling Leading Industry Stakeholders and Their Strategic Initiatives Shaping Innovation and Competitive Positioning in the Cleanroom Door Sector

A cadre of established and emerging companies is propelling innovation and competition in the cleanroom airtight sliding door sector. Global access control firms have fortified their portfolios through targeted acquisitions of specialty cleanroom door manufacturers, integrating advanced sealing technologies and software-enabled diagnostics. At the same time, pure-play cleanroom equipment providers are differentiating through modular designs that accelerate installation timelines and simplify validation protocols.

Strategic collaborations between door system suppliers and cleanroom integrators are also gaining traction, enabling turnkey delivery models that encompass doors, airlocks, and auxiliary environmental controls. Leading players are investing heavily in R&D to refine sealing materials, enhance panel strength, and embed IoT-enabled sensors for real-time performance monitoring. Some innovators are exploring hybrid door concepts that combine automatic operation with manual override features to address emergency access scenarios.

Regional champions in Asia-Pacific are leveraging cost leadership and local supply chains to undercut global incumbents, while North American and European firms emphasize premium service offerings, extended warranties, and comprehensive maintenance plans. These divergent yet complementary strategies reflect a market in which breadth of capabilities and depth of specialization both serve as pathways to competitive advantage.
